When choosing a ventilator battery, several factors come into play, including capacity, longevity, weight, and compatibility with various ventilator models. The ideal battery will offer a balance between these features to ensure functionality and portability. Here’s a look at some of the best ventilator battery options available today.
One of the top choices for ventilator batteries is the Li-ion battery type. Known for their high energy density and lightweight design, Li-ion batteries provide long-lasting power, making them ideal for portable ventilators. These batteries can typically last between 8 to 12 hours on a single charge, depending on the ventilator's usage and settings. The rapid charging capabilities of Li-ion batteries also mean less downtime, which is critical in emergency situations.
Another popular option is the Nickel-Metal Hydride (NiMH) battery. While they are generally heavier than Li-ion batteries, NiMH batteries are known for their robustness and longevity. They often have a lower self-discharge rate, which means they can hold their charge longer when not in use. Many hospitals and medical facilities prefer NiMH batteries for stationary ventilators due to their reliability in long-term applications.
For those looking for high-capacity options, the Lithium Polymer (Li-Po) battery is gaining attention. These batteries offer a flexible design, can be molded into various shapes and sizes, and are often lighter than their counterparts. Li-Po batteries typically provide longer runtimes, making them suitable for portable ventilators used in home care scenarios. However, it’s essential to ensure that the specific Li-Po battery is compatible with your ventilator model before making a purchase.

In addition to the types of batteries, consider practicality and safety features. Most modern ventilator batteries come equipped with built-in protection circuits to prevent overcharging, overheating, and short circuits. Some models even offer monitoring features that allow users to check the remaining battery life easily, reducing the risk of being caught off guard.

Finally, it's essential to maintain and regularly service your ventilator battery to ensure reliability. Routine checks on battery health and performance can prevent unexpected failures. Following the manufacturer’s recommendations for charging and handling can help prolong the life of the ventilator battery.
